Output 5d7fc8aefd144e29a0e1104a3959a3c0e82d9648a02b9861f99d3fe0d61fa52c:0

value
30014260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abd0d7c9c270138f7e718fdf7c3edc79330ca6ec OP_EQUAL
address
MPZdxto5TCr3p8XLW1WgHdBh8AtbB1e9m6
transaction
5d7fc8aefd144e29a0e1104a3959a3c0e82d9648a02b9861f99d3fe0d61fa52c
spent
true